Marine Krasovska is the Head of the Financial Technology Supervision Department of Latvijas Banka. She holds a Master's Degree in Finance from the University of Latvia and a professional diploma in Management from the Open University Business School (UK). She has also completed the Oxford Strategic Innovation Programme at Said Business School, and the Innovations and AI programme at INSEAD.
She gained professional experience in managerial positions at SEB bank, DNB bank and Luminor Bank. In 2020, she became the Director of the Financial Innovation Department at the Financial and Capital Market Commission (FCMC). Following the integration of FCMC into Latvijas Banka on 1 January 2023, she assumed her current position as Head of the Financial Technology Supervision Department.
Marine is recognised for her dynamic and proactive work within the fintech community, contributing significantly to Latvia's emergence as a fintech hub. She has also shared insights on financial innovation as guest lecturer at Riga Technical University and Riga Business School.
